What is Cryptocurrency CFD Trading?


CFD trading allows traders to speculate on the price movement of an asset without owning the underlying asset itself. When trading cryptocurrency CFDs, you are essentially entering into a contract with a broker to exchange the difference in the asset's price between the time you open and close the trade.

For example, when trading Ethereum CFDs, you don't buy or sell real ETH tokens. Instead, you take a position based on whether you believe the price of ETHUSD (Ethereum priced in US dollars) will rise or fall. If your prediction is correct, you profit from the price difference, minus any fees or spreads charged by the broker.



Why Trade Ethereum CFDs?


Ethereum’s unique position in the crypto market offers several advantages for CFD traders:

1. Access to a Leading Cryptocurrency
Ethereum is the second-largest cryptocurrency by market capitalization after Bitcoin. It powers a vast ecosystem of decentralized applications (dApps) and smart contracts, making it a highly liquid and actively traded asset.

2. Leverage Opportunities
CFDs allow traders to use leverage, meaning you can open positions larger than your initial investment. This amplifies potential profits but also increases the risk of losses.

3. Ability to Go Long or Short
With Ethereum CFDs, you can profit from both rising and falling markets. Going long means you buy expecting the price to increase, while going short means you sell expecting the price to decrease.

4. No Need for Cryptocurrency Wallets or Exchanges
Trading CFDs eliminates the need to deal with cryptocurrency wallets, private keys, or exchanges. This simplifies the process and reduces security risks like hacking or wallet loss.

5. Regulated Trading Environment

Risks Involved in Ethereum CFD Trading


While Ethereum CFD trading offers many benefits, it also carries risks:

Market Volatility
Cryptocurrency markets are highly volatile, and ETH prices can fluctuate rapidly, which can result in significant gains or losses.

Leverage Risks
Leverage magnifies both profits and losses. Traders can lose more than their initial deposit if not managed carefully.

Counterparty Risk
When trading CFDs, you rely on the broker as the counterparty. Broker insolvency or poor practices can affect your trades.

Regulatory Risks
Cryptocurrency regulations vary by jurisdiction and can impact market access or trading conditions.

Overnight Fees
Holding CFD positions overnight often incurs swap or rollover fees, which can add up over time.
